package com.puppycrawl.tools.checkstyle.checks.whitespace;
import com.puppycrawl.tools.checkstyle.api.Check;
import com.puppycrawl.tools.checkstyle.api.TokenTypes;
import com.puppycrawl.tools.checkstyle.api.DetailAST;
/**
* <p>
* Checks that a token is followed by whitespace, with the exception that it
* does not check for whitespace after the semicolon of an empty for iterator.
* Use Check {@link EmptyForIteratorPadCheck EmptyForIteratorPad} to validate
* empty for iterators.
* </p>
* <p> By default the check will check the following tokens:
* {@link TokenTypes#COMMA COMMA},
* {@link TokenTypes#SEMI SEMI},
* {@link TokenTypes#TYPECAST TYPECAST}.
* </p>
* <p>
* An example of how to configure the check is:
* </p>
* <pre>
* <module name="WhitespaceAfter"/>
* </pre>
* <p> An example of how to configure the check for whitespace only after
* {@link TokenTypes#COMMA COMMA} and {@link TokenTypes#SEMI SEMI} tokens is:
* </p>
* <pre>
* <module name="WhitespaceAfter">
* <property name="tokens" value="COMMA, SEMI"/>
* </module>
* </pre>
* @author Oliver Burn
* @author Rick Giles
* @version 1.0
*/
public class WhitespaceAfterCheck
extends Check
{
@Override
public int[] getDefaultTokens()
{
return new int[] {
TokenTypes.COMMA,
TokenTypes.SEMI,
TokenTypes.TYPECAST,
};
}
@Override
public void visitToken(DetailAST aAST)
{
final Object[] message;
final DetailAST targetAST;
if (aAST.getType() == TokenTypes.TYPECAST) {
targetAST = aAST.findFirstToken(TokenTypes.RPAREN);
// TODO: i18n
message = new Object[]{"cast"};
}
else {
targetAST = aAST;
message = new Object[]{aAST.getText()};
}
final String line = getLines()[targetAST.getLineNo() - 1];
final int after =
targetAST.getColumnNo() + targetAST.getText().length();
if (after < line.length()) {
final char charAfter = line.charAt(after);
if ((targetAST.getType() == TokenTypes.SEMI)
&& ((charAfter == ';') || (charAfter == ')')))
{
return;
}
if (!Character.isWhitespace(charAfter)) {
//empty FOR_ITERATOR?
if (targetAST.getType() == TokenTypes.SEMI) {
final DetailAST sibling =
(DetailAST) targetAST.getNextSibling();
if ((sibling != null)
&& (sibling.getType() == TokenTypes.FOR_ITERATOR)
&& (sibling.getChildCount() == 0))
{
return;
}
}
log(targetAST.getLineNo(),
targetAST.getColumnNo() + targetAST.getText().length(),
"ws.notFollowed",
message);
}
}
}
}
